WebDiatomaceous Earth (DE) is a naturally occurring type of silica rock that is razor sharp on the microscopic level. It is comprised of 90% silica and is the result of fossilization of hard shelled animals called diatoms that lived many years ago (>100,000). DE is used as an insecticide as well as a source of Silica for soil mixes. The ultra fine powder (DE) …

Diatomaceous earth , diatomite (/daɪˈætəmaɪt/ dy-AT-ə-myte) or kieselgur/kieselguhr is a naturally occurring, soft, siliceous sedimentary rock that can be crumbled into a fine white to off-white powder. It has a particle size ranging from more than 3 mm to less than 1 μm, but typically 10 to 200 μm. Depending on the granularity, this powder can have an abrasive feel, similar to pumice powder…

WebMar 29, 2024 · Will using diatomaceous earth contaminate the soil in my garden? The main component of DE is silicon. This is the most common element in the soil. Silicon is also the main ingredient of sand.
